The Kyoto Handicraft Center, located in the heart of Kyoto, Japan, is a three-story haven for those interested in traditional Japanese arts and crafts. Visitors can explore a wide array of local handicrafts, including kimonos, decorative fans, pottery, and dolls. The center not only offers a diverse selection of items for purchase but also provides an immersive experience through classes where participants can learn various traditional crafts. Additionally, visitors have the opportunity to rent kimonos, allowing them to fully embrace the cultural atmosphere.
